The Importance of Energy-Efficient Windows
Windows are more than just openings that enable light and fresh air into a home. They are important elements of a building's thermal envelope, which helps to keep a consistent indoor temperature. Energy-efficient windows are created to lessen heat transfer, reduce drafts, and avoid air leakage, ultimately causing lower cooling and heating costs. According to the U.S. Department of Energy, windows can account for 25% to 30% of domestic heat loss and gain. For that reason, guaranteeing that windows remain in great condition is vital for maintaining a home's energy performance.
Common Window Problems and Their Impact on Energy Efficiency
Before diving into the repair procedure, it's important to determine the typical problems that can affect window performance. Here are a few of the most regular problems:

Drafts and Air Leaks:
Causes: Cracks, spaces, or worn-out weatherstripping.Impact: Drafts can significantly increase cooling and heating expenses by permitting conditioned air to escape and unconditioned air to go into.
Broken Seals:
Causes: Aging, exposure to severe temperatures, or physical damage.Impact: Broken seals in double- or triple-pane windows can result in fogging and reduce insulation properties.
Worn-Out or Damaged Frames:
Causes: Moisture damage, termite problem, or general wear and tear.Effect: Damaged frames can trigger air leaks and make it challenging to open or close windows, causing increased energy usage.
Faulty Hardware:
Causes: Rust, corrosion, or mechanical failure.Impact: Malfunctioning hardware can avoid windows from closing correctly, triggering air leaks and reducing energy efficiency.
Cracked or Broken Glass:
Causes: Physical impact or thermal tension.Effect: Broken glass not only positions a safety risk however also permits considerable heat loss or gain.Steps for Energy-Efficient Window Repair
Fixing energy-efficient windows can be a simple process if you follow these steps:

Identify the Problem:
Conduct a thorough evaluation of all windows to determine any concerns such as drafts, fogging, or harmed frames.Utilize a candle light or incense adhere to discover air leakages by moving it around the [window screen replacement](https://hedgedoc.k8s.eonerc.rwth-aachen.de/9Y4rL-kqQx-gPkGBwQwkVQ/) frame and noting where the flame flickers.
Seal Air Leaks:
Weatherstripping: Apply weatherstripping around the window frame to seal spaces and prevent air leaks. Common types include foam, rubber, and vinyl.Caulking: Use a premium, weather-resistant caulk to seal gaps in between the window frame and the wall.Insulating Films: Install insulating films on the window glass to reduce heat transfer and enhance energy effectiveness.
Replace Broken Seals:
Diagnosis: If you notice condensation or fogging between the panes of double- or triple-pane windows, the seal is likely broken.Repairs: In some cases, the seal can be fixed by reapplying a sealant. However, if the damage is comprehensive, it might be essential to replace the whole window unit.
Repair or Replace Damaged Frames:
Assessment: Check for indications of wetness damage, rot, or termite problem. If the damage is small, you can often repair the frame.Repair: Sand down any rough locations, apply a wood filler, and repaint or stain the frame.Replacement: For serious damage, think about changing the entire window frame. Modern materials such as vinyl, fiberglass, and composite offer outstanding sturdiness and energy efficiency.

While some window repairs can be dealt with as DIY jobs, others might need expert help. Here's a breakdown to help you choose:

DIY Repairs:
Sealing Air Leaks: Applying weatherstripping and caulking.Servicing Hardware: Cleaning and lubricating hinges and locks.Minor Frame Repairs: Sanding and painting.
Expert Repairs:
Replacing Broken Seals: This frequently requires customized tools and expertise.Changing Damaged Frames: Professional installation guarantees an ideal fit and correct sealing.Changing Glass: Safety issues and the requirement for exact measurements make this a job finest left to specialists.Regularly Asked Questions (FAQs)
How do I understand if my windows need repair?
Common indications include drafts, fogging, problem in opening or closing, and noticeable damage to the frame or glass.
What is the most typical cause of window leaks?
Worn-out weatherstripping and gaps in the caulking are the most frequent causes of air leaks around windows.
Can I repair a damaged seal myself?
Sometimes, you can reapply a sealant, but for comprehensive damage, it is suggested to speak with a professional.
What materials are best for energy-efficient windows?
Vinyl, fiberglass, and composite products provide excellent durability and energy efficiency.
How typically should I check my windows?
It is advisable to inspect windows at least as soon as a year, preferably before the start of the heating or cooling season.
